Housing Options for Expats
Chiang Rai provides a diverse range of housing options suited to various budgets and lifestyles. Expats can choose from:
- Condos: Modern condominiums in the city center offer conveniences such as proximity to shops, restaurants, and amenities. Many condos come with facilities like swimming pools, gyms, and 24-hour security.
- Single-family Homes: For those seeking more space, single-family homes in quieter neighborhoods provide a sense of community and security. Many homes come with gardens, making them ideal for families or those looking for a peaceful retreat.
- Apartments: Affordable apartments are plentiful and can often be rented on a monthly basis, making them a great option for short-term stays or long-term commitments.

Navigating Legal Considerations
Understanding the legalities surrounding property ownership in Thailand is crucial for expats. Foreigners can own condos outright but may face restrictions on land ownership. Here are key points to consider:
- Foreigners can own 49% of the total area of a condominium project.
- To buy land, expats often need to set up a Thai company or use long-term lease agreements.
- Consulting a qualified local attorney is advisable to help navigate legalities and ensure compliance with Thai property laws.
Cost of Living and Affordability
One of the most appealing aspects of living in Chiang Rai is the low cost of living. Housing expenses are significantly lower than in major cities like Bangkok or Phuket. Expats can enjoy a comfortable lifestyle with affordable groceries, dining, and leisure activities. This affordability makes Chiang Rai an attractive option for retirees and digital nomads looking to maximize their investment.
